East Cobb Turf Conditions

Cobb County clay is dense and compacted, especially in the older, established lots throughout East Cobb. Native drainage is slow, which means standing water after rain is common—a real problem for RV pads and commercial entries where pooling leads to rutting and long-term settling. We design our base layers to work *with* that clay, not against it, using proper gravel beds and perforated underlayment so water moves through instead of sitting on top. Sun exposure varies significantly depending on your lot size and tree canopy. The neighborhoods here have mature landscapes, so shade is common on the north and east sides of properties. We choose turf pile heights and blade types based on your specific sun-shade pattern—lighter, more open blades for shaded zones where airflow matters, denser systems for full-sun RV pads. East Cobb HOAs and commercial properties often have strict landscape maintenance requirements. Artificial turf satisfies those rules while eliminating mowing, herbicide spraying, and the mud-tracking issues that plague natural grass in high-traffic commercial zones. Installation on clay requires careful site prep—we compact and level before laying base, because shortcuts here mean settling problems two years down the road.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I really need artificial turf for an RV pad in East Cobb, or will sod work?

Natural sod will give you two seasons, maybe three, before Cobb's clay and your RV's weight create ruts and bare patches. Artificial turf is engineered for that kind of traffic. It won't compress, won't mud up after rain, and won't require re-sodding every couple of years. For a commercial-grade RV pad, it's the difference between a temporary fix and a 10-year solution.

How does artificial turf handle Cobb County's heavy clay and drainage issues?

We don't fight the clay—we build around it. Our base system includes gravel, perforated underlayment, and proper slope so water drains through instead of pooling on top. This is critical in East Cobb where standing water is a real problem. We've installed systems in Indian Hills and the Pope area that outperform natural grass by years because drainage is engineered, not hoped for.

Will artificial turf fade or look plastic-y in East Cobb's sun?

Quality commercial turf is UV-stabilized and designed to look natural for a decade or more. East Cobb's tree-covered lots actually give you shade relief that helps preserve color. We use turf blades that mimic real grass texture and tone—not the bright green carpet look from 15 years ago. Your neighbors won't mistake it for fake.

How long does installation take, and how soon can I use my RV pad?

Full installation in East Cobb typically runs 3–5 days depending on site prep and size. You can use it immediately after we finish—no curing time like concrete.
